Is Tenured/ Tenure Track Yes Full-time/ Part-time Full-time Job Description Summary Chicago State University (CSU), is the oldest public university in the Chicago metropolitan area. Chicago State University is Illinois’ only four-year U.S. Department of Education-designated

Predominantly Black Institution (PBI). CSU serves over 1,500 undergraduate students and nearly 900 graduate students. The university is a nationally accredited university with five colleges in Arts and Sciences, Business, Education, Health Sciences and Pharmacy and proudly supports a diverse and non-traditional student population that hails from 28 countries and 36 states. Chicago State University Department of Art and Design invites applications for a 9-month, tenure-track position as Assistant Professor of Art History, beginning August 2026. We are looking for a faculty member who is committed to excellence in teaching, scholarly research, and student success in a diverse and inclusive

environment. Candidates should demonstrate a strong commitment to dynamic and innovative undergraduate teaching and support activities that encourage unique learning opportunities in our University Gallery program as well as the classroom. Additional responsibilities include maintaining an active program of scholarly research, supporting student mentorship and professional development along with department and

university service. Required Education The desired applicant must have a Ph.D. in Art History or a related equivalent subject. Required Knowledge, Skills and Abilities The successful candidate will develop curriculum and teach a range of art history courses, from Ancient and Medieval through Modern and Contemporary subject matter, in a BA Degree program with degree options in 2D & 3D Studio Art, Design, and PK-12 Art
